Turn the cylinder head over
so the head gasket surface
faces up. Once again locate the
front head bolt dowel hole and
corresponding row of seven head
bolt holes. From an accurate
location of the centerline of this
row of head bolt holes, measure
and scribe a reference line the
length of the head 5.670 inches
[144mm] toward the intake port
side of the head. This line will
be the corner intersection of the
head gasket surface and the new
intake manifold seal surface. (See
Figure 2)
The intake manifold seal surface
must be machined at an 85°
angle to the head gasket surface
(5° off a vertical when installed
on the engine). The machining
may be done using a block/head
surfacer or a milling machine
with enough table travel to cover
the length of the head. The cut

will likely require a number of
passes to reach the finished
dimension at the 85° angle. (See
Figure 3) The finished surface
cut should come to or be just
below the rocker cover gasket
rail surface on the intake face of
the head. 100% clean-up of the
as-cast head below the rocker
cover rail flange is not required.
